COUNTY OWNER HAS BIG TEST TO COME

LP_0903_MAIN_LPE1_001

NEW Notts County owner Alan Hardy has made a laudable stand in sacking John Sheridan for abusing officials. He has also made a rod for his own back.
Sheridan, who is appealing his dismissal, was jettisoned shortly after Hardy’s takeover in January, following a verbal outburst during a 2-0 defeat by Wycombe the previous month.
“I am not prepared to tolerate any member of my staff abusing referees and officials in this manner,” said Hardy.
